Job Summary

Special Education Aide- Transitions- ASD in Grand Rapids, MI provides team-based support for scholars with disabilities. Responsibilities include planning, implementing, and evaluating strategies for individual and group behavioral management and transitioning goals; assisting in instruction and preparation of materials; participating in IEP-related activities and school events; assisting with transportation and supervision of students on and off campus (including pool activities under supervision); implementing community-based instructional programs; supporting medical, adaptive daily living, and self-care tasks; lifting and transferring scholars as needed; ensuring safety and order during school day activities; performing record-keeping tasks (attendance, behavior planning, Medicaid billing for personal care services, files, and information sent home); and communicating effectively with co-workers, parents, and the community. Must meet minimum education/assessment requirements and have the ability to work in varied conditions; preferred bachelor’s degree. The role emphasizes dependable attendance, professionalism, and a positive role modeling. ADA accommodations information provided by Human Resources. The wage is determined by the collective bargaining agreement.

Required Qualifications

  • Completed a minimum of 60 college credits earned
  • or obtained an associate’s degree or higher
  • or obtained a passing score on an MDE approved ETS Paraprofessional assessment
  • Preferred Qualification: Bachelor’s degree
  • Must be able to work in a variety of weather conditions
  • Must be capable of safely restraining scholars when necessary in accordance with approved protocols
  • Must be able to enter and participate in swimming and/or pool activities with students
  • Must be able to provide supervision during field trips, activities, and while transporting students
  • Must be able to physically push wheelchairs and assist with lifting and transferring students
  • Ability to supervise scholars to ensure a safe environment
  • Effective written and oral communication skills
  • Ability to work with confidential information
  • Ability to work in a diverse environment
